Responsible for one of the most original releases of 2010 with his self titled album, Eskmo has just released an ambient remix EP, featuring several of his tracks, “chopped, sliced, washed and stretched beyond beyond, then washed again with warmth”. Album highlights such as Cloudlight and Siblings get the trusted distortion technique to magnificent effect.
